The Four Winds
Two stations stand on the verge of town, one on each side of the bare highway, both sunk in darkness. Martha chooses at random, the Conoco on her right, pulls into the parking lot and cuts the engine. The cold is quick to take the pickup’s interior, flooding the wind-worn window seals.
There are no lights in the parking lot. No lights inside the small building. The gas pump beside them shows no sign of life, no glowing display illuminating prices.
